CVE-2012-6497: The Authlogic gem for Ruby on Rails, when used with certain versions before 3.2.10, makes potentially unsaf...

The Authlogic gem for Ruby on Rails, when used with certain versions before 3.2.10, makes potentially unsafe find_by_id method calls, which might allow remote attackers to conduct CVE-2012-6496 SQL injection attacks via a crafted parameter in environments that have a known secret_token value, as demonstrated by a value contained in secret_token.rb in an open-source product.

This is a legacy Rails authentication-library issue. It matters when an application used affected Authlogic versions before 3.2.10 and its Rails secret_token was known or exposed. Under those conditions, attackers might reach a related Rails SQL injection flaw. Evidence is conditional and incomplete, with no CVSS score or KEV listing. Exposure is most likely in old Ruby on Rails applications using Authlogic before 3.2.10, especially open-source or leaked deployments where secret_token values were published. Current exposure cannot be inferred without dependency and secret-history review. Treat this as a targeted legacy-app review item, not a broad emergency. Prioritize internet-facing Rails systems, public-source deployments, and applications with unknown secret-management history. Business risk rises materially if secrets were exposed. Mitigation focus: Identify Rails applications that use the Authlogic gem.; Upgrade Authlogic to 3.2.10 or later where affected.; Check vendor guidance for Rails CVE-2012-6496 remediation..
